The Design Process
Most projects will commence in a very different form to the website which is eventually published.
At the outset, the client would be
presented with a brief summary of our ideas regarding the layout and colours of the site by
means of a series of graphics. These form the basis upon which
the design process will proceed, in consultation with the client, until the overall look of the site is
agreed.
Once the design is finalised, the different pages required to
achieve it are created.
The example below illustrates the design process for a website for Eleven Didsbury Park - a
contemporary townhouse hotel. The top row of graphics are different "looks" for the site. The bottom row shows examples of the final agreed design, including different pages, such as the home page, a page illustrating the hotel, and text descriptions.
